This vehicle has a parasitic drain issue that kia is aware of on this model. the issue was addressed for all lx, ex, limited, and sx of this vehicle except for the sxl. i have the sxl version and was told by kia it did not meet the vin requirements even though it meets the born on date and has the same issues as the others. i have had my vehicle tested by a kia master tech and it does have a parasitic drain (battery dead after vehicle sits for 48 hours) from the same drivers door switch addressed in tsb ele-069. i believe that kia has overlooked the sxl models in their recalls as my vehicle is a 2014 and has only had the sa-163a update performed (also the only one listed for my vin) and my vehicle has many of the same issues as the others have. kia addressed the issue at hand on all the others, lx, limited, ex, and sx, with nhtsa id 10109757 and kia tsb ele-069, ele-057, and sa-163. i would like to have the sxl vehicles looked into as i believe they are not getting the required tsb's addressed properly.

I have a 2014 lx with nothing special other than heated front seats. regular ignition, 6cyl with almost 148k miles. issue 1- at approx 100k my dash started lighting up with abs, e-brake, trac, and tps lights. ebrake and tps were intermittent and only came on after it rained it seemed. after plugging it up and getting no codes i took it to the dealer june 2017 and they informed me it was no big deal but it was part of a recall for a sensor. however, kia had not provided them with the necessary tools to fix it. it's now august 2018 and i am still waiting. issue 2- at approx 130k miles my steering controls for bluetooth and radio stopped working. the radio itself works, but when attempting to seek or adjust volume with steering controls the voice command pops up. issue 3- at approx 145k cruise control stopped working. i can turn it on and set speed, but in less than a mile it disengages. i have found if i turn off the eco it works as it should. issue 4 i found today. after getting a message from a random stranger through my advertised business on the back window i was informed that i have no brake lights except for the one on top (third). i just replaced them in july after a random stranger told me that they were out. when i got the message (after making my 60 mile commute to work) i grabbed a coworker to come out and troubleshoot with me. we checked fuses and they are fine. third light works, tail lights work, turn signals and backup lights work. we took apart the tail light assembly and pulled the bulbs to check them and the bulbs are still intact (filament still completely intact) but the bulbs are charred black and the harness socket appears to have gotten extremely hot. also the bottom of the bulb is glossy like it melted.

I purchased a 2014 kia sorento lx brand new from the dealer. i have maintained all necessary work and mostly done at authorized dealers. in may 2017 while driving home my instrument panel went out. unable to see speed, safety warning lights, gas etc... i took it to two different kia service locations to trace problem. they found a wire shorted to ground on the trailer hitch wiring which came with vehicle. they cut the wires to trailer harness and this issue also damaged my remote starter. they replaced the blown fuse with a larger fuse and said it was all set. however it happened again on 09/29/17. this time when i parked my car and tried to start again, it wouldn't come out of park so i had it towed to dealer. it is out of warranty now but they are not willing to fix this issue which is over $3,000 to fix. there is a few feet of burned and melted wiring that i have pictures of, unsure of exact wiring, but it connected to the wiring trailer hitch harness. it was apparently close to catching on fire. since i owned the vehicle other odd electrical issues have happened, including blown headlights and brake lights on about 8 occasions. i only found one recall relating to the trailer hitch wiring harness #16v862000 however it does not include my year vehicle. in my opinion, this is a very unsafe condition and safety concern that kia needs to research further for possible other recalls.
